School vision statement

"Bloomingdale High School will maintain the highest standards of excellence for all students in the pursuit of academic, social, and civic responsibilities."

School Mission Statement

"Students, staff, parents, and community members will work together to ensure a safe learning environment and provide a wide-range of knowledge and experiences to help students formulate their lifelong goals and the ability to succeed in the global community."
